Fujian Fleet

The Fujian Fleet (simplified Chinese: 福建水师; traditional Chinese: 福建水師; pinyin: Fújiàn Shuǐshī; Pe̍h-ōe-jī: Hok-kiàn Chúi-su or simplified Chinese: 福州舰队; traditional Chinese: 福州艦隊; pinyin: Fúzhōu Jiànduì) founded in 1678 as the Fujian Marine Fleet was one of China's four regional fleets during the closing decades of the nineteenth century. The fleet was almost annihilated on 23 August 1884 by Admiral Amédée Courbet's Far East Squadron at the Battle of Fuzhou, the opening engagement of the Sino-French War (August 1884 – April 1885).
